Beyond DRM: The New Era of Secure and Interactive WebRTC Streaming
Digital video consumption has rapidly evolved from static, on-demand playback to highly dynamic, interactive live experiences. While Digital Rights Management (DRM) has long been the gold standard for content protection, the industry is now looking beyond DRM to tackle new challenges, ranging from real-time interactivity to user-specific piracy deterrence. At the same time, technologies like WebRTC streaming are reshaping how video platforms deliver ultra-low-latency experiences. Together, these shifts are defining the future of secure, scalable, and engaging video delivery.
Why Beyond DRM?
Traditional DRM focuses on encrypting and licensing content to ensure only authorized viewers can access it. While this remains essential for protecting premium video assets, piracy threats have expanded beyond simple illegal downloads. Screen recording, credential sharing, link hijacking, and illicit restreaming are all common today.
Going beyond DRM means adopting a multi-layered approach:
Watermarking: Dynamic, viewer-specific watermarks deter screen capture by tying leaks back to the source.
Access Control: Features such as domain restriction, geo-blocking, and IP-based authentication ensure playback only happens in authorized environments.
Analytics & Tracking: Advanced dashboards now track suspicious behavior like concurrent logins, abnormal session lengths, or unusual geographic patterns.
Piracy Identification: Tools that detect and report unauthorized usage enable platforms to act quickly against infringements.
This holistic approach ensures that while DRM protects the encryption and licensing layer, complementary technologies protect the full lifecycle of content delivery.
WebRTC Streaming and the Push for Real-Time
At the same time, the way audiences consume video is changing. Traditional HLS and DASH protocols offer adaptive playback but often introduce 5–30 seconds of latency, unacceptable for live classrooms, gaming, or interactive events.
This is where WebRTC streaming steps in. Originally designed for peer-to-peer video calls, WebRTC delivers end-to-end latency under one second. This near-real-time performance makes it ideal for:
Virtual Classrooms: Teachers can engage directly with students without delays, enabling true back-and-forth interaction.
Sports and E-sports: Fans experience events as they happen, without the frustration of delayed commentary or spoilers.
Trading and Financial Streams: Real-time information is crucial for decisions where even milliseconds matter.
Interactive Commerce: Live shopping streams can combine product demos with instant customer engagement.
WebRTC streaming bridges the gap between broadcast-quality delivery and conversational interactivity, setting the foundation for new categories of video applications.
The Intersection: Secure, Low-Latency Streaming
When we combine the philosophy of beyond DRM with the capabilities of WebRTC, video platforms gain both protection and performance. However, this intersection also introduces unique challenges:
Scalability vs. Latency: While WebRTC is perfect for low-latency, scaling it to tens of thousands of viewers requires infrastructure optimization and hybrid architectures.
Encryption in Motion: DRM systems are traditionally built for file-based encryption, while WebRTC is a continuous peer-to-peer protocol. Integrating real-time encryption with license enforcement is a key technical innovation.
Piracy Prevention in Live Contexts: Unlike static video, live WebRTC streams can be captured instantly. Watermarking overlays and session tracking become critical to discourage leaks.
Device & Browser Variability: Ensuring compatibility across browsers and devices while maintaining DRM-grade security within WebRTC’s ecosystem requires ongoing engineering investment.
Despite these hurdles, the result is powerful: a system that delivers secure, real-time video without compromising user experience.
The Future of Video Security
The future of secure streaming will not be defined by DRM alone. Instead, platforms are moving toward integrated ecosystems that include:
AI-driven piracy monitoring to detect leaks across the web.
Zero-trust access policies where every stream session is authenticated continuously.
Hybrid protocol delivery, combining WebRTC for real-time needs and HLS/DASH for scalable broadcasts.
Granular analytics to help creators and educators understand not just who is watching, but how they are engaging.
For businesses, whether in education, media, sports, or enterprise communications—the path forward lies in balancing three pillars: security, interactivity, and scalability.
Conclusion
The streaming industry is entering an exciting phase where protecting content goes beyond DRM and where interactivity thrives through WebRTC streaming. Together, these advancements empower platforms to offer secure, low-latency experiences that meet the expectations of today’s global audiences.
The challenge now is not just to deliver video, but to deliver it safely, instantly, and in a way that builds trust between creators and viewers. By moving beyond encryption alone and embracing holistic security plus real-time engagement, video platforms can future-proof themselves in an era where both piracy and user expectations are constantly evolving.

Suzuki Fuel & Oil System Components Guide: What to Check First When Performance Drops
When a Suzuki outboard starts acting up, the cause is often smaller than the symptom suggests. Hard starting, hesitation, rough idle, surging, and warning alarms can all begin with a minor weak point in the fuel or oil system.
The goal is not to replace parts blindly. It is to trace the symptom to the right system, inspect the parts most likely to fail first, and then choose compatible replacements. Once you know the issue is fuel-related, the correct category of Suzuki parts fuel components can help narrow the repair without turning it into guesswork.
How to Diagnose Suzuki Fuel and Oil System Issues Without Guessing
Begin with when the problem happens. An engine that struggles on cold start points to a different diagnostic path than one that idles well but bogs when the throttle opens. A warning alarm should also be treated differently from a performance complaint, even if both happen during the same trip.
Use the symptom to decide your first inspection path:
- Starting or idle issues: look for poor priming, stale fuel, filter restriction, or unstable low-speed fuel supply.
- Bogging or surging: focus on flow under load, including the tank, venting, hoses, fittings, and pump-side delivery.
- Alarms or oil warnings: inspect oil level, oil-side hardware, caps, lines, and any engine-specific warning conditions before assuming a mechanical failure.
This approach keeps the repair logical. Fuel delivery problems usually affect how consistently the engine receives clean fuel. Oil-system issues are more about lubrication supply, monitoring, and system integrity. Some symptoms overlap, but the inspection should not.
Before ordering, decide whether the suspect part is a normal wear item or a more durable component. Filters, hoses, primer bulbs, seals, clamps, and connectors often age out first. Pumps, tanks, fittings, and oil-delivery hardware may fail too, but they deserve a more deliberate diagnosis.
What Suzuki Fuel and Oil System Components Usually Include
A Suzuki fuel system is made up of the parts that store, move, filter, and deliver fuel to the engine. Depending on the setup, that can include fuel lines, primer bulbs, filters, water-separating filter assemblies, connectors, clamps, fittings, fuel pumps, and tank-related hardware.
Oil-system components vary more by engine configuration. They may include oil tanks, caps, lines, delivery parts, seals, sensors, and mounting or connection hardware. On engines with oil-related alerts, these parts become especially important because a compromised component can trigger a warning before the operator notices a running issue.
The important point is that these systems are only as reliable as their weakest connection. A clean filter will not help if the hose feeding it is cracked. A secure fitting will not solve a venting restriction. A new cap may not matter if the seal below it is damaged.
The Most Common Mistakes Owners Make
Many owners start with the part they can see instead of the part the symptom actually suggests. A primer bulb, for example, is easy to blame, but it may only be reacting to a restriction or air leak elsewhere.
Another common mistake is treating one failed part as an isolated event. If a hose end is brittle, the clamp is corroded, or a connector no longer seats cleanly, nearby parts may be in a similar condition. Reusing them can leave the original problem partially unresolved.
The third mistake is ordering by appearance. Marine components can look nearly identical while differing by model, year, horsepower, or system layout. Fitment should be confirmed with exact engine information, not a visual match.
Why Shopping for the Fuel and Oil System as a Group Saves Time
Looking at the system as a group does not mean replacing everything at once. It means building a complete parts list for the repair you have already diagnosed.
If a filter is being replaced, check whether the seals, fittings, or clamps involved in that service should be refreshed at the same time. If a fuel line is damaged, inspect the connector and attachment points before placing the order. If an oil tank cap or line is suspect, review the related seals or hardware before assuming the single visible part is enough.
This prevents one of the most frustrating repair delays: fixing the obvious item, then discovering that a small supporting component was also needed. For owners who trailer to the water or travel for boating weekends, a missed clamp or connector can cost more in lost time than the part itself.
Why Small Fuel or Oil Components Often Cause Big Repair Delays
Small components create big delays because they sit at critical control points. Fuel filters affect flow quality. Primer bulbs affect priming. Connectors and clamps affect sealing. Hoses affect both flow and air intrusion. Oil caps, lines, and seals help maintain the integrity of the oil side.
When one of these parts fails, the symptom can feel like a larger engine problem. A motor that loses power under load may seem to have a major performance issue, but the cause could be restricted fuel flow. A warning may feel severe, but the first step is still to inspect the relevant system and confirm the source.
The costliest mistake is rushing the diagnosis. Replacing the wrong component adds downtime, shipping delays, and another round of troubleshooting. A better approach is to identify the system involved, inspect the likely failure points, and order the correct compatible parts once.
Quick Inspection Checklist Before Ordering
| Checkpoint | What to Confirm |
| Symptom timing | Cold start, idle, acceleration, cruising, or alarm event |
| Fuel quality | Water, debris, stale fuel, or visible contamination |
| Flow path | Tank, vent, hose routing, primer bulb, filters, fittings |
| Oil-side condition | Oil level, cap seal, lines, tank condition, warning behavior |
| Wear signs | Cracks, stiffness, swelling, corrosion, loose clamps |
| Fitment | Exact Suzuki model, horsepower, year, and system category |
Do this inspection with the engine off and in a safe, ventilated area. If the issue involves alarms, repeated stalling, fuel leakage, or oil delivery concerns, do not keep running the engine to “test it” until the cause is understood.
FAQ
Why does my Suzuki outboard run fine at idle but bog under throttle?
That pattern often points to a flow problem that only appears when demand increases. The first checks are fuel quality, tank venting, filters, hoses, fittings, and pump-side delivery.
Can a bad primer bulb cause performance problems?
Yes, but it is not always the root cause. A primer bulb that collapses, will not stay firm, or feels unusually soft may indicate restriction, air intrusion, or a bulb that has aged out.
When should I suspect an oil-system issue instead of a fuel issue?
Suspect the oil side when the concern involves oil warnings, visible oil leakage, damaged oil lines, low oil supply, or components tied to the engine’s lubrication system. Performance symptoms alone are not enough to assume an oil fault.
Is it safe to keep running the engine if the problem comes and goes?
Intermittent symptoms should still be taken seriously. A temporary restriction, air leak, or oil-side warning can become more severe under load. Inspect before the next trip rather than waiting for the issue to become consistent.

Yamaha DEC Controls Guide: Digital Controls, Compatibility, and What Buyers Overlook
Digital controls often look simpler than they are. From the helm, the decision can seem mostly visual: choose the control box, match the layout, and move on. With Yamaha DEC, that approach usually creates confusion later.
Buyers looking at Yamaha DEC controls usually make better decisions when they define the project first. Some are replacing an existing digital component. Others are trying to sort out a broader rigging question. Those are very different buying situations, even if the hardware looks similar at a glance.
Digital Controls Are Not Just a Different Handle Style
The practical difference is straightforward. DEC manages throttle and shift electronically rather than through a conventional mechanical-style control arrangement. That changes more than the feel at the helm. It also changes how the control setup relates to the engine and the rest of the rigging.
This is where buyers often go off track. They compare visible hardware as if they were choosing between similar standalone parts. In reality, digital controls belong to a specific application path. The wrong question is “Which box looks right?” The better question is “What kind of setup is this boat actually built around?”
A few assumptions cause problems early:
- assuming similar-looking controls are interchangeable
- treating digital controls like a cosmetic replacement
- focusing on the helm hardware before checking application details
Not Every DEC Purchase Is the Same Kind of Project
This is the section buyers often skip, and it is where most clarity comes from. Before comparing products, figure out which of these situations applies:
| Project type | What it usually means |
| Direct replacement | The boat already has a digital setup, and the goal is to replace a matching component |
| Incomplete existing setup | The current rigging needs to be identified before any part can be ordered confidently |
| Re-rig or upgrade | The purchase is part of a broader control and rigging decision |
| Unclear legacy setup | The visible hardware may not be enough to identify what the boat actually needs |
These are not small differences. A direct replacement tends to be narrower and easier to verify. A re-rig or mixed setup requires more caution because the control box is only one piece of the decision.
What Buyers Need to Verify Before Ordering
Once the project type is clear, the next step is verification. This is where the buying process becomes more practical and less speculative.
Check these first:
- exact Yamaha engine model details
- whether the engine application supports digital controls
- whether the current helm and rigging setup already matches that path
- whether supporting components are part of the same order
This is also the point where buyers should slow down if the boat’s history is unclear. On boats that have been repowered, modified, or pieced together over time, the control hardware at the helm may not reflect the full story. Ordering based only on what is visible can lead to missing parts, mismatched components, or a return that could have been avoided.
What Buyers Most Commonly Overlook
The biggest oversight is not technical complexity. It is incomplete thinking at the start. Buyers often know what part they want to replace, but they have not fully defined what they are trying to preserve, restore, or change.
What gets overlooked most often is usually one of these:
- the difference between replacing and reconfiguring
- the need to confirm the wider rigging context
- the possibility that the current setup is not fully original
- the fact that visible similarity does not confirm compatibility
That is why DEC purchases can feel more confusing than expected. The issue is rarely just the product. It is the project definition behind it.
Why DEC Buying Gets Expensive Faster Than Expected
The expensive part of a DEC purchase is often not the control box itself. It is the cost of ordering too early. When buyers move before the application is clear, the project starts to accumulate hidden costs in the form of returns, missing supporting parts, installation delays, and second-round ordering.
That pattern usually looks like this:
| Early mistake | Later consequence |
| Price the control box first | The budget ignores the rest of the setup |
| Order by appearance | Compatibility issues show up after delivery |
| Skip application verification | The wrong part enters the project too early |
| Treat the project as isolated | Additional needs appear after the first order |
A more disciplined approach usually costs less overall, even if it feels slower at the beginning.
DEC Pre-Order Checklist
Before ordering, write down the engine model, identify whether the boat is already running a digital setup, review the wider rigging context, and note whether the purchase is a direct replacement or part of a bigger change. If you cannot answer those points clearly, the order probably needs more verification first.
FAQ
Can two Yamaha DEC control boxes look similar and still belong to different applications?
Yes. Visual similarity is not a reliable compatibility test. Controls that look nearly identical may still belong to different application paths.
Is it easier to buy DEC parts for a boat with a known rigging history?
Yes. A well-documented setup removes a lot of guesswork. Boats with repower history or partial modifications usually require more verification before ordering.
Why do buyers make mistakes even when they already have a DEC setup onboard?
Because having digital controls already installed does not automatically mean every related replacement part is interchangeable. Exact application still matters.
What usually makes a DEC order feel more complicated than expected?
Not the visible hardware itself, but the need to confirm what surrounds it: engine application, current rigging logic, and whether the project is a simple replacement or something broader.
